Output 65521cb632bba3f75f23e3c69676fed18b6a8c9feb941ef7776541b7f4e00a62:1

value
838030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d665fb541f85bdc98c105af948ac734182ccfe1e OP_EQUAL
address
3MEehQqgjih5GK3RZ761CiLJKUxV4RBdxr
transaction
65521cb632bba3f75f23e3c69676fed18b6a8c9feb941ef7776541b7f4e00a62
confirmations
198658
spent
true